Current Research Project Khalid al-Kindi

Renewal of Arabic Grammar in the Light of the Probation Theory

The Probation Theory serves most of the sciences and is based on ontological, epistemological, and metallinguistic foundations. It is ontological because it reconsiders existence through six higher categories called probationers, namely: unit, act, relation, condition, emotions, and time. It is epistemological because it analyzes human knowledge in the various sciences, discusses the philosophy that stands behind its awareness, corrects its origins on which it was built, evaluates its terminology, and provides a mechanism for the precise separation of its overlapping concepts. It is a metallinguistic because it is a new organon that regulates thinking through a unified language that has a new idiomatic and conceptual apparatus.

Probation theory is a plan to analyze a topic, looking at the opinions and studies that have been said about it, and trying to enumerate the parties concerned with it, and the ideas that pertain to it, then classify these parties and ideas and everything related to it into the six highest categories that are called basic probationers, which are: unit, act, condition, relationship, emotion, and time, then it considers (the necessary and indispensable relationships between them to separate terms with overlapping concepts, and to reach the scope of operation of any science), and secondary relationships that are used for further clarification in differentiating between terms with overlapping concepts, and what is between the probationers (direct relationships that are understood when declaring the act in the sentence or perceiving it with the senses, while declaring both sides of the relationship or perceiving them with the senses. Declaring these probationers gives the understood relationship a literal meaning. It has no implied meaning and transcendent relationships in which the event is not declared and is not perceived by the senses. However, the relationship can be inferred due to the existence of either or one of the two parties to the relationship, because the parties to the relationship are conditions that are similar to the effects left by the act, as if they are signs that guide one to the act despite its expiration and annihilation.

In Probation Theory, we have presented studies, and here we will suffice with mentioning what represents the stage of maturity:

  • Multiple Functional Significance of the Object, a Study in the Light of Probation theory, Journal of the Union of Arab Universities for Literature, Volume 19, Issue 2, 2022.
  • The Problematic of the Grammatical Term, Its Concept and Subject in "The Councils of Scholars" in the Light of Probation Theory, Al-Manara Magazine, Al al-Bayt University, Volume 2, Issue 1, 2023.
  • Renewing the Grammatical and Linguistic Lesson in Light of the Probation Theory, Omani Writers Association, 2024.
